第二章:設(shè)置數(shù)據(jù)庫
第四節(jié):UltraDev與各種數(shù)據(jù)庫的連接代碼
我們使用Ultradev的時候,可以選擇使用多種數(shù)據(jù)庫,比如我們常用的access數(shù)據(jù)庫、sql數(shù)據(jù)庫,mysql等等。Ultradev在與各種數(shù)據(jù)庫連接的時候,所需要的數(shù)據(jù)庫連接代碼是不同的。在自己電腦中,可以使用DSN、自定連接字符;在數(shù)據(jù)庫服務(wù)器上,可以使用DSN、 自定連接字符或是Server.Mappath;朋友們在初學的時候,容易混淆。在這個系列教材中,我在這里列舉一些出來,作為參考。
ODBC DSNLess connection
?。ú恍枰狣SN連接)
MS Access ODBC DSNless 連接
Driver={Microsoft Access Driver (*.mdb)};Dbq=c:\somepath\dbname.mdb;Uid=Admin;Pwd=pass;
dBase ODBC DSNless 連接
Driver={Microsoft dBASE Driver (*.dbf)};DriverID=277;Dbq=c:\somepath\dbname.dbf;
Oracle ODBC DSNless 連接
Driver={Microsoft ODBC for Oracle};Server=OracleServer.world;Uid=admin;Pwd=pass;
MS SQL Server DSNless 連接
Driver={SQL Server};Server=servername;Database=dbname;Uid=sa;Pwd=pass;
MS Text Driver DSNless 連接
Driver={Microsoft Text Driver (*.txt; *.csv)};Dbq=c:\somepath\;Extensions=asc,csv,tab,txt;Persist Security Info=False;
Visual Foxpro DSNless 連接
Driver={Microsoft Visual FoxPro Driver};SourceType=DBC;SourceDB=c:\somepath\dbname.dbc;Exclusive=No;
MySQL DSNless 連接
driver={mysql}; database=yourdatabase;uid=username;pwd=password;option=16386;
以上只是列舉了一些在使用asp時,用到的數(shù)據(jù)庫的常用的ADO連接的代碼。不過要注意,在自定連接代碼對話框中,每個連接代碼只能為一行,不能另起一行,否則就認不出來。如果出現(xiàn)換行的情況,您得自己動手,將它們連接起來。